About You
You thrive in a fast-paced environment and enjoy the challenge of meeting deadlines. With a strong desire to help clients, you bring a service-oriented mindset to everything you do. You're highly organized, capable of managing your own workload, and confident in your ability to deliver accurate payroll processing daily.
In this role, you will be part of a large outsourced payroll team, using various software applications to provide payroll services to clients. Communication, both written and verbal, is key as you will be supporting clients through email and phone. If you love the rhythm of daily payroll processing and take pride in precision, this position is a perfect fit.
Your day-to-day:
- Main point of contact for your nominated clients.
- Prepare employee payment calculations including standard pay, bonus, termination, leave & overtime.
- Process payrolls within 24 hours of receipt or as agreed with client.
- Provide clients with Payslips and STP reporting within 24 hours of payment or as per legislation.
- To monitor client communications to ensure they are responded to for general enquiries, special out of cycle payrolls and requests for manual payments.
- Answer telephone enquiries.
- Process third party payments such as PAYG to ATO, Child Support, Superannuation, Salary Packaging.
- Complete reconciliations for Payroll Tax (if established).
- Assist in the planning and implementation of legislative changes to payroll that affect clients, such as changes to superannuation, taxation reporting.
- Assist clients with audit reporting.
- Assist clients with project work including costing restructure, leave recalculations, superannuation adjustments, update salaries, generate backpays, explain overpayments/underpayments.
- Assist other team members achieve the daily goals of all payrolls completed and banked on time.
- Reconcile general ledgers and reports to ensure they balance prior to sending to clients.
- Ensure client payroll processing notes are maintained.
- Complete end of financial year reconciliation and provide STP Final Event to client to submit.
- Update cases in Salesforce.
- Keep payroll knowledge skills up to date.
Skills and Experience
- 2 years of payroll administrative experience
- Knowledge of date-based and period-based payroll systems
- Intermediate pro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ite, especially Excel
- Strong attention to detail and accuracy
- Motivated to complete tasks and meet deadlines
- Willingness to help and support others
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Ability to self-manage with high organizational skills
Education:
- Diploma or equivalent
